Some new HQ images of Don Doragoku.
Some funfacts from this weeks Donbros blog https://www.toei.co.jp/tv/donbrother...9221_3246.html Apparently one of the original ideas for Donbrothers was for it to be Journey to the West themed instead of Momotaro themed. This idea got shelved cause of confusion on how to incorporate the theming, and because Dairanger and Kakuranger already has some Journey to the West theming. The idea to make Doragoku dragon themed was to separate him from SaruBrother who was already monkey themed, citing how Ryusei-Oh from Dairanger was a dragon with Son Goku influnces, so Doragoku is kind of the reverse. |
